Site description (2000 baseline)
A 22-km long stretch of the River Rhine (Rijn), close to Gelderse Poort (048), between the villages of Heteren and Amerongen (industry plants excluded). The site includes the river channel and surrounding flood-plain, the latter being mainly used for dairy farming, and is bounded by the winter dykes.
Key biodiversity
The average seasonal peak number of waterbirds during 1992-1996 was more than 20,000.
